日時関数を提供するスクリプトユニットです。
メソッド |
---|
function addYears(value: datetime, years: decimal): datetime 日付と時刻に年を追加します。 |
function addMonths(value: datetime, months: decimal): datetime 日付と時刻に月を追加します。 |
function addDays(value: datetime, days: decimal): datetime 日付と時刻に日を追加します。 |
function addHours(value: datetime, hours: decimal): datetime 日付と時刻に時間を追加します。 |
function addMinutes(value: datetime, minutes: decimal): datetime 日付と時刻に分を追加します。 |
function addSeconds(value: datetime, seconds: decimal): datetime 日付と時刻に秒を追加します。 |
年、月、日、時、分、秒を指定して日付と時刻を作成します。 |
function fromDate(value: date): datetime 時刻を00:00:00に設定して、日付を日付と時刻に変換します。 |
function fromDateAndTime(dateValue: date, timeValue: time): datetime 日付と時刻の値を指定して日付と時刻を作成します。 |
function days(startValue: datetime, endValue: datetime): decimal 2つの日付と時刻の間の日数を返します。 |
function seconds(startValue: datetime, endValue: datetime): decimal 2つの日付と時刻の間の秒数を返します。 |
日付と時刻に年を追加します。
パラメーター:
value:入力日時
months:追加される年数。整数である必要があります。
戻り値:
新しい日時。パラメーターがnullの場合はnullとなります。
日付と時刻に月を追加します。
パラメーター:
value:入力日時
months:追加される月数。整数である必要があります。
戻り値:
新しい日時。パラメーターがnullの場合はnullとなります。
日付と時刻に日を追加します。
パラメーター:
value:入力日時
months:追加される日数。整数である必要があります。
戻り値:
新しい日時。パラメーターがnullの場合はnullとなります。
日付と時刻に時間を追加します。
パラメーター:
value:入力日時
hours:追加される時間数。整数である必要があります。
戻り値:
新しい日時。パラメーターがnullの場合はnullとなります。
日付と時刻に分を追加します。
パラメーター:
value:入力日時
minutes:追加する分数。整数である必要があります。
戻り値:
新しい日時。パラメーターがnullの場合はnullとなります。
日付と時刻に秒を追加します。秒の小数部はミリ秒の精度でサポートされています。
パラメーター:
value:入力日時
seconds:追加される秒数。小数部は小数点以下3桁に丸められます。
戻り値:
新しい日時。パラメーターがnullの場合はnullとなります。
年、月、日、時、分、秒を指定して日付と時刻を作成します。秒の小数部はミリ秒の精度でサポートされています。
パラメーター:
year:入力年
月:入力月
日:入力日
hours:入力時間
分:入力分
second:入力秒。小数部は小数点以下3桁に丸められます。
戻り値:
新しい日時。パラメーターがnullの場合はnullとなります。
時刻を00:00:00に設定して、日付を日付と時刻に変換します。
パラメーター:
value:入力日
戻り値:
新しい日時。パラメーターがnullの場合はnull。
日付と時刻の値を指定して日付と時刻を作成します。
パラメーター:
dateValue:入力日
timeValue:入力時間
戻り値:
新しい日時。パラメーターがnullの場合はnullとなります。
2つの日付と時刻の間の日数を返します。この関数は、days(toDate(startValue)、toDate(endValue))と同等です。
パラメーター:
startValue:入力開始日時
endValue:入力された終了日時
戻り値:
日数。パラメーターがnullの場合はnullとなります。
2つの日付と時刻の間の秒数を返します。秒の小数部はミリ秒の精度でサポートされています。
パラメーター:
startValue:入力開始日時(両端を含む)
endValue: 入力された終了日時のみ
戻り値:
秒数。パラメーターがnullの場合はnullとなります。